Introduction to the Surname 'Ameen'

The surname 'Ameen' (often spelled as 'Amin') is of significant interest in the realm of onomastics, the study of names. This surname, steeped in cultural and historical implications, is prevalent in various regions around the world, particularly in countries across the Middle East, South Asia, and among diaspora communities. The name is often derived from the Arabic word 'Ameen,' which translates to 'faithful' or 'truthful.' This characteristic attribute not only adds depth to the name but also reflects the sociocultural values of honesty and trust within communities where it is prominent.

Geographical Distribution

The surname 'Ameen' has notable incidences across multiple countries. Understanding its geographical spread can shed light on migration patterns, cultural exchanges, and the historical significance of communities associated with the surname.

Pakistan

Pakistan accounts for the highest incidence of the surname 'Ameen,' with a remarkable count of 226,213 individuals bearing the name. This figure reveals the popularity of the surname in the country, suggesting influential familial lineages and potential historical roots tied to the Islamic culture prevalent in the region.

Egypt

Egypt follows with approximately 34,097 occurrences of the surname 'Ameen.' The presence of this surname in Egypt can be linked to the country’s rich Islamic heritage, where names depicting positive attributes hold cultural significance. In Egyptian society, the name may symbolize both identity and religious affiliation.

Sudan

In Sudan, the surname 'Ameen' is recorded with 14,244 incidences. Given Sudan's historical connections with Islamic civilization, the surname likely reflects a similar cultural importance as seen in Pakistan and Egypt, marking it as a name that signifies trust and reliability.

Saudi Arabia

Saudi Arabia shows an incidence of 11,683 individuals with the surname 'Ameen.' The name resonates well in this region, where Arabic names often carry Islamic connotations. The link to the Islamic faith enhances the respect and values associated with the surname.

Other Countries

Countries such as Sri Lanka, Bangladesh, India, and several Middle Eastern nations also host notable populations with the surname. The occurrences are as follows:

  • Sri Lanka: 8,698
  • Bangladesh: 7,932
  • India: 6,967
  • United Arab Emirates: 3,371
  • Nigeria: 3,085
  • South Africa: 1,579
  • United States: 1,376

Religious Implications

The term 'Ameen' in Islamic tradition is often used at the end of a prayer, signifying the affirmation of the requests made. This religious connection gives the surname a spiritual resonance, and individuals with this name may be perceived as embodying the qualities associated with faith and piety.
